Brigitte Rougeron (born 14 June 1961 in Paris) is a retired French high jumper.

She finished fifth at the 1985 European Indoor Championships.[1] She became French champion in 1981 and 1986.[2]

Her personal best jump was 1.92 metres, achieved in May 1984 in Haguenau.[3]

Her coach was Marc Schott.
